At Bigblue, we're building the logistics backbone for the next generation of commerce. Modern brands sell everywhere: through their own online stores, marketplaces, retail, social commerce, and more. Across every channel, customers expect the same fast, reliable, and transparent experience after they buy. What used to be Amazon's exclusive advantage is now becoming the standard for every ambitious brand. We're helping them get there. Since 2018, we've built a tech-driven fulfilment platform used by 600+ brands, including Muji, Aigle, Scuffers, and Cabaïa. With 200+ Bigbluers across the UK, France, Spain, and Germany, our proprietary tech stack, and a network of 9 warehouses and over 100,000 sqm of fulfilment space across Europe, we ship millions of orders every month. And we're nowhere near done! Backed by €20M+ in funding, we're expanding across Europe and building the operating system that will power modern commerce operations at a global scale.
